How Autopilot Actuators Are Driving Innovation
The quick development of autonomous cars is largely fueled by progress in autopilot devices. These essential components, responsible for accurately controlling steering, throttle, and braking, are experiencing significant innovation. We’re seeing developing designs incorporating cutting-edge materials like slim composites and miniaturized electric drives, leading to higher efficiency and responsiveness. The drive for enhanced safety and dependability is also encouraging research into redundant actuator systems and smart control algorithms, ultimately influencing the future of driverless transportation.
